We are in for a rare treat, albeit maybe a lopsided one, as two games will be played Monday night.

The 2-0 Bills take on the 0-2 Jaguars in Game 1.

The line isn't as long as one might expect at Bills -4.5. In fact, Sagarin suggests this one is right on the money at 4.85.

Key matchup

Jaguars O-Line vs. Greg Rousseau and Von Miller. Jacksonville has already allowed seven sacks, including a safety. Rousseau had three sacks in a season-opening win over Arizona. And Miller has a sack in each outing after failing to have one in 14 games, including playoffs, while coming off a torn knee ligament last season.

The Commanders vs. Bengals line is a bit longer at Cincinnati -7.5.  Sagarin suggests this is a slight underlay as they get a number of 8.33.

The Bengals are 0-2 while Washington is 1-1.

Joe Burrow was much better in Week 2 than in the opener. The fifth-year quarterback with a surgically repaired right wrist was 23 of 36 for 258 yards and two touchdowns in the Bengals' 26-25 loss to Kansas City on Sunday. Washington has allowed 455 total passing yards over two games.
